Z Grills Wood Pellet Grill & Smoker – Key Features
The Z Grills Wood Pellet Grill & Smoker is unique in the marketplace, using compact wood pellets instead of the traditional gas or charcoal fuel system.
This makes for a different cooking experience that could even be seen as superior by some enthusiasts.
Here are the key features that you’ll want to know about:
- Automatic pellet hopper and feed system.
- Automatic temperature maintenance.
- Electric ignition system.
- Large cooking area with a 513 square inch main cooking rack.
- 187 square inch warming rack.
- 20 lbs. pellet capacity.
- Up to 450° F temperature setting.
- Extended 3-year manufacturer warranty.

The biggest advantage to using wood pellets is the flavor that you can give your food.
Wood smoke has a unique savory flavor with complex elements that can depend on the type of pellets that you use.
Maple wood pellets and applewood pallets are examples that can be used to add sweeter flavors.
Hickory pellets add a rich smoky flavor that is reminiscent of southern roadhouse cooking.
The smoked flavor doesn’t need to be overpowering, as you can choose the exact type of pellets that you want to cook with.
The downside is that you won’t be able to achieve the more neutral flavors that you could with a regular gas grill.
This might be seen as a disadvantage by some, but there are plenty of other quality grill options if the authentic smoky flavor is not what you’re after.

Design Elements That Make the Z Grills Wood Pellet Grill & Smoker a Winner
We’ve already mentioned the electronic temperature control that offers a true set-and-forget experience, and there’s plenty more that this grill can offer.
The automated pellet system is a huge advantage and it takes away the inconvenience and mess that is found in some other pellet grill systems.
The hopper is completely automated and can hold 20 lbs. of wood pellets.
This is plenty for a long grilling session, so you won’t have to worry about refilling it in most cases. Simply fill it up before you get started, and you’re ready to go.
The electronics will automatically replace the pellets as they burn, maintaining a constant temperature inside that will allow for better cooking at more accurate temperatures.
Consistency is one thing that many home grill enthusiasts struggle with, but the controlled nature of cooking with the Z Grills will completely eliminate this problem.
The pellet purge system is also automated, so you don’t need to worry about regularly cleaning the hopper.
Once the pellets are depleted you will simply need to refill them, although, as has been mentioned, this is not something that you will need to do during even a longer grilling session.
The grill produces approximately 25,000 BTUs per hour, which is on par with most other grills of this size.
The average gas burner produces around 5000 BTUs, so you could think of this model as being equivalent to a 5 burner gas grill.

The Z Grills Wood Pellet Grill & Smoker doesn’t require extensive maintenance, but it can collect ash inside the cooking chamber after extended use.
Because there are no gas burners in the way, it’s quite a simple job to get things cleaned up.
Ash that is left (and not deposited into the grease tray) can simply be vacuumed out, and this is something that several consumer reviews have recommended.
